Located about eight miles north of Downtown Seattle, the area of Lake City was once a railroad stop. It was named in 1906 and quickly developed into a suburb of Seattle. During Prohibition, the area was unincorporated. So when Seattle joined Prohibition, Lake City supplied the roadhouses and speakeasies barred from the nearby city. Lake City became a Seattle neighborhood in the mid-1950s. With Lake Washington as the neighborhood’s sparkling gem, residents are rediscovering this northern neighborhood.
Lake City stretches from the lake to roughly 15th Avenue in North Seattle.
